Understanding Vicarious Trauma: What It Is and How to Address It
What is Vicarious Trauma?
Vicarious trauma refers to the emotional residue and psychological impact experienced by individuals who are exposed to the trauma of others. It often stems from an empathetic connection, where the caregiver or supporter becomes deeply involved in the other person’s experiences.
